Sharp inequalities for linear combinations of orthogonal martingales

arXiv:1803.04570

Abstract

For any two real-valued continuous-path martingales and , with and being orthogonal and being differentially subordinate to , we obtain sharp inequalities for martingales of the form with real numbers. The best constant is equal to the norm of the operator from to , where is the Hilbert transform on the circle or real line. The values of these norms were found by Hollenbeck, Kalton and Verbitsky \cite{HKV}.
